Greenville, ALButler County, Alabama
Latitude: 31.831273 Longitude: -86.627567Population 7,104 (2005)Elevation of Greenville, Alabama: 395 feet |
|
Population 2005: 7,104 Population 2004: 7,052 Population 2003: 7,076 Population 2002: 7,097 Population 2001: 7,236 Population 2000: 7,228 (2000 Census) Population 1990: 7,492 (1990 Census) Population Growth 2000 to 2005: -1.72% Population Growth 1990 to 2000: -3.52% Population (2000 Census): 7,228 Male: 3,231 (44.70%) Female: 3,997 (55.30%) Median age: 38.10 years Races, 2000 Census: White: 50.30% Black or African American: 48.31% Hispanic or Latino: 0.86% Asian: 0.36% Two or more races: 0.30% American Indian: 0.28% Other race: 0.06% Housing Units: 3,324 (2000 Census) Land Area: 21.1543 square miles Water Area: 0.1757 square miles Most populous zip code: 36037 |
